Browse all contacts at Red Barn Veterinary Clinic

Contact people working at Red Barn Veterinary Clinic, Red Barn Veterinary Clinic employees, Red Barn Veterinary Clinic contacts

Other employees and contacts in Red Barn Veterinary Clinic
1